The 03906 housing market is very competitive. The median sale price of a home in 03906 was $451K last month, up 30.3% since last year. The median sale price per square foot in 03906 is $329, up 20.7% since last year.
In March 2024, 03906 home prices were up 30.3% compared to last year, selling for a median price of $451K. On average, homes in 03906 sell after 51 days on the market compared to 10 days last year. There were 9 homes sold in March this year, down from 10 last year.

Flood Factor
03906 has a minor risk of flooding. 116 properties in 03906 are likely to be
severely affected
by flooding over the next 30 years. This represents 7% of all properties in 03906. Flood risk is increasing slower than the national average.

Fire Factor
03906 has a moderate risk of wildfire. There are 2,154 properties in 03906 that have some risk of being affected by wildfire over the next 30 years. This represents 94% of all properties in 03906.

Wind Factor
03906 has a Major Wind Factor® risk based on the projected likelihood and speed of hurricane, tornado, or severe storm winds impacting it. 03906 is most at risk from hurricanes. 1,967 properties in 03906 have some risk of being in a severe wind event within the next 30 years.
